David Cassidy Sues Over Profits From 'Partridge Family' Merchandise

October 5th, 2011 2:33pm EDT
David Cassidy
Former teen idol David Cassidy is taking his battle for merchandising compensation from his days on 1970s show The Partridge Family to court.

The singer/actor shot to fame as Keith Partridge on the popular ABC sitcom in 1971, before embarking on a pop career.

Network bosses continually used his image to sell products branded with the hit series, but Cassidy only realized earlier this year that ABC executives had raked in approximately $500 million from the merchandise - and he has been seeking a share of the profits ever since.

Singer William Cowsill Dies At 58

February 20th, 2006 11:17am EST
William Cowsill, part of the sixties singing Cowsills family, has died at the age of 58. Cowsill lost a battle with emphysema, osteoporosis, and other ailments in Calgary, Canada, on Friday, February 17, 2006.

The band - which comprised brothers Barry, William, Bob and John, sister Susan and mother Barbara - were the inspiration for TV hit The Partridge Family and had a number of chart hits including Hair and The Rain, The Park And Other Things.

Barry was killed last year (05) when Hurricane Katrina struck his New Orleans, Louisiana, home. William is survived by two sons.
